Trust Stamp Closes Two M&A Deals
Trust Stamp announced the closing of two M&A transactions. They acquired Lexverify Ltd and subscribed for a 50% ownership interest in Cyberfish CyberPsychology Solutions Ltd. The deals aim to bolster Trust Stamp's AI-powered trust, identity, and security solutions.
Trust Stamp's acquisition of Lexverify, finalized on February 27, 2026, was an all-stock deal paid in four tranches, aiming to add expertise in Large Language Models (LLMs) and expand access to the UK market. Lexverify, founded in 2020 and headquartered in Birmingham, UK, offers an AI-powered risk management platform that identifies compliance risks in electronic communications. Their platform helps businesses prevent legal, compliance, and cyber risks in real-time, providing training and insights to navigate regulatory requirements. Lexverify's AI assistant scans electronic communications for potential risks like violations of competition law, financial sanctions, and GDPR, minimizing exposure and offering continuous employee training. In 2024, Lexverify secured £900,000 in seed funding led by Midven, with participation from Raspberry Ventures, The LegalTech Fund, and angel investors. Lexverify participated in the NCSC For Startups program and the Cyber Runway accelerator. Trust Stamp's other acquisition, Cyberfish CyberPsychology Solutions Ltd, was founded in 2018. CyberFish specializes in cyber incident response simulations designed by cybersecurity, psychology, and neuroscience experts. Their simulations create realistic, high-pressure scenarios to build "muscle memory" for effective crisis response, improving team bonds and decision-making under stress. Trust Stamp, founded in 2016, provides AI-powered identity verification solutions. In Q3 2025, Trust Stamp reported a 71% increase in net recognized revenue compared to the same period in 2024. The company's Q2 2025 revenue increased 62% year-over-year to $0.81 million, with a 34% reduction in net losses. Trust Stamp's technology is protected by 11 issued and allowed patents, with 12 patents pending as of January 2022.
